Lightning Peak

Drill Permitted Gold/Silver Project

The Lightning Peak property is a 2,890 hectare property located 60km South East of Vernon, BC and 35 kilometers south of Cherryville, BC. The project is easily accessible throughout, due to a robust logging road network throughout. The project covers prospective ground within rocks of the prolific Quesnellia Terrane.


The property covers nine known British Columbia mineral occurrences and a new occurrence discovered in 2020. These occurrences consist of historical exploration trenches or small-scale mining operations from the late 1800s and early 1900s. During a property inspection carried out by Eagle Plains personnel in the summer of 2020, rock grab samples from the Morning workings ranged from trace values to highs of 39.4 grams per tonne gold and 912 grams per tonne silver (sample TTLPR016) and 1.31 grams per tonne gold, 205 grams per tonne silver, 1.88 per cent lead, 5.03 per cent zinc and 0.12 per cent cadmium (sample TTLPR015).


2020 prospecting led to a new discovery, referred to as the Aurum Vena showing. It consists of numerous local float boulders containing brecciated semi-massive sulphides that consistently contain highly elevated gold, lead and zinc mineralization, with values ranging from trace quantities to highs of 5.84 grams per tonne gold, 30.6 grams per tonne silver, 3,680 parts per million lead and 674 parts per million zinc (sample TTLPR010 -- float boulder).


The project is now permitted for drilling and trenching.

Eastgate

Copper, Zinc, Gold

The Eastgate Property is located approximately 1.5 km to the east of Manning Park, approximately a 2.5 hour drive from Vancouver, BC. The property borders the small township of Eastgate, BC to the south and covers a section of East Ladner. The property is found on NTS mapsheet 092H02E and split down the middle by BCGS mapsheets 092H017 and 092H018. A total of 9 mineral tenures a cover 528.2 hectares. The property is owned by the author, and was built up by initially staking tenure 1104223. Tenure 1106654 was later staked in August and finally 1099057 was purchased in the same month. In 2024 the remaining Red Star claims were dropped by the neighbouring company and acquired through staking and purchasing to amalgamate the current project package.


The project hosts 5 BC Minfile occurences including the past producing Red Star Copper/Zinc mine. 


The project has seen work dating back to the early 1900s with most of the focus on the Red Star mine, including 300 m of underground development. In the mid 1960s A total of 40 tons of ore was mined and resulted in 31.1 grams of gold, 2612.7 grams of silver, 2345.5 kilograms of copper and 2932.5 kilograms of zinc produced.


2024 sampling on the Red Star On the Red Star  helped verify some of the described mineralization at the mine site. Of special interest was sample 996449 that returned 1.76% Cu and 48.8% Zn from a large Sphalerite boulder that has been described as Sphalerite lenses. Elevated copper was also found in a quartz grab sample 996450 that returned 0.57 ppm Au and 3.22% Cu.


At the Pasayten Gold area the sampling also verified gold in the vein system with a dump grab sample 114709 yielding 21.8 g/tonne Au.

Khrysos

Khrysos - Gold/Silver

Property Description

Khrysos (Gold) is a child of Zeus; neither moth nor rust devoureth it; but the mind of man is devoured by this supreme possession.- Pindar, Fragment 222 (trans. Sandys) (Greek lyric 5thcentury BC)


The 725 ha Khrysos Property is an exciting newly acquired property BC's Monashees. Theproperty hosts narrow high grade silver gold veins.


Highlights/opportunities:

· Easy access

· Limited previous exploration

· Select samples are reported to have assayed up to 54.60 grams per tonne gold and 1380

grams per tonne silver

· Room to expand

· Multi-year permit for drilling and trenching


In 2022 sample number 997707, a choice grab of pyrite and sphelerite rich pods returned 31 g/tonne gold and 762 g/tonne silver. Meanwhile a 1.1m chip returned 13.8 g/tonne gold and 92.2 g/tonne silver.

Silver Bell

Khrysos - Gold/Silver

The Monashee (Silver Bell) Property is a 538.5 hectares (ha) Silver/gold project near

Cherryville, BC. There are three showings found on the property; these consist of the SILVER BELL (082LSE011), BEL 1-2 (082LSE054), and JRG 1-4 (082LSE036) showing.

On the No. 1 vein, a 12-metre adit was driven along a 0.2 to 2 metre wide quartz vein and a

shear zone on the north side of the vein. The shear zone and the vein are both mineralized. The shear trends 285 degrees and dips 65 degrees north and the vein strikes 120 degrees and dips near vertical. There are no records of ore shipped from the adit. Two samples assayed up to 1744.8 grams per tonne silver and up to 5.3 grams per tonne gold (Assessment Report 16783).


The No. 2 vein, located about 15 metres southwest of the No. 1, trends 290 degrees and dips 62 to 75 degrees. The vein contains patchy sulphides along late fractures near the northern margin of the vein. Three chip samples across this vein assayed up to 1984.8 grams per tonne silver and 3.5 grams per tonne gold (Assessment Report 16783)


2023 grab samples at the JGR showing returned:

996412- 3.9gpt Au 1,100 gpt Ag

996420 -16.4gpt Au 65 gpt Ag
